
以下是为企业设备批量下载并安装谷歌浏览器的方法:
1. 通过组策略统一部署Chrome
- 在域控制器上→打开“组策略管理”→创建新策略→命名为“企业Chrome安装”→应用到目标OU(组织单元)。
- 配置计算机策略→导航到“计算机配置”→“策略”→“Windows设置”→“脚本(启动/关机)”→添加“关机脚本”。
- 编写批处理文件(如 `install_chrome.bat` )→内容包含:
batch
@echo off
powershell -Command "Invoke-WebRequest -Uri 'https://dl.google.com/tag/stable/googlechromestandaloneenterprise64.msi' -OutFile '%TEMP%\chrome.msi'"
msiexec /i %TEMP%\chrome.msi /quiet /norestart
→保存脚本并关联到组策略的关机任务→确保重启后自动安装。
2. 使用微软Intune推送安装包
- 登录Intune管理门户→选择“应用程序”→点击“添加”→选择“Win32应用”。
- 上传Chrome企业版MSI文件→填写应用名称和描述→设置安装命令为 `msiexec /i chrome.msi /quiet` →指定卸载命令。
- 在“分配”页面→选择“用户组”或“设备组”→勾选目标对象→点击“分配”→员工登录设备时自动触发安装。
3. 通过SCCM部署静默安装
- 在SCCM控制台→创建新应用程序→导入Chrome企业版MSI包→检测依赖关系。
- 配置部署类型→选择“静默安装”→设置参数 `/quiet /norestart` →禁用用户交互界面。
- 创建集合(如“未安装Chrome的电脑”)→将部署包关联到该集合→立即分发→客户端自动下载并安装。
4. 自动化脚本适配多场景
- 使用PowerShell脚本→检测系统架构(32位/64位)→动态下载对应版本的Chrome安装包:
powershell
$arch = if ($env:PROCESSOR_ARCHITECTURE -eq "AMD64") {"64"} else {"32"}
Invoke-WebRequest -Uri "https://dl.google.com/tag/stable/googlechromestandaloneenterprise$arch.msi" -OutFile "chrome.msi"
msiexec /i chrome.msi /quiet
- 集成到AD登录脚本→在用户首次登录时→自动检查并安装Chrome→避免手动干预。
- 结合任务计划→设置脚本每周执行一次→检查版本号→自动更新到最新版。
5. 配置浏览器策略与锁定设置
- 在组策略中→启用“禁止用户修改浏览器设置”→导航到“用户配置”→“管理模板”→“Google”→“Chrome”。
- 强制启用企业功能→如“禁用扩展商店”“限制主页修改”→防止员工随意更改配置。
- 通过MasterPreferences文件→定义默认搜索引擎、标签页布局→分发到每台设备→保持统一体验。
6. 验证安装状态与版本控制
- 使用SCCM报表→生成“软件清单”→筛选Chrome版本→统计未安装或过时的设备→定向修复。
- 在终端执行命令 `wmic product get name,version` →检查Chrome版本号→比对最新版本→决定是否升级。
- 通过Intune合规性策略→设置“要求安装指定版本的Chrome”→未满足条件的设备提示合规警告→强制安装更新。